この記事は yosida95.com に移動しました。 新しい URL は https://yosida95.com/2012/02/12/231528.html です。 お手数をお掛けしますが、ブックマークの付け替えをお願いします。
この記事は yosida95.com に移動しました。 新しい URL は https://yosida95.com/2012/02/12/231528.html です。 お手数をお掛けしますが、ブックマークの付け替えをお願いします。
GETでlong-polling→メッセージ受信 POSTでメッセージ送信 でSkypeBotを作れます。 SkypeBotをつくろうと思ってRubyのライブラリを探したのだけど一番よさ気なライブラリがPythonのSkype4Pyだったとさ。Python避けてきたのに。 どうせならRubyとかPerlとかPHPとかAppEngineからも簡単にSkypeBotを作れるべきなのでWebAPI化してしまえばいいじゃないですか。 WebでリアルタイムでPythonといえばTornadoとは噂には聞いていたので、うっかり手を出したらいとも簡単にlong-pollingなサーバができてしまい拍子抜けました。Tornadoやばい。 Pythonの感想 メソッド名のルールが謎、大文字小文字 クラスメソッドとインスタンスメソッドの名前がかぶるとダメ? クラス変数とインスタンス変数の名前がかぶるとダメ?
最近ターミナルからSkypeをしたいなーと思うことがよくありました。検索してみるといくつかターミナルからSkypeを実行するものが見つかりますが、いまいち自分に合うものがなかったので、Skype4PyというSkypeAPIのPythonラッパーを使って、ターミナルからSkypeが出来るSkyshというものを作りました。Mac OS Xでしか動作確認してないですが,Skype4PyとPythonが使える環境なら使えると思います(ansi colorを使ってるのでwindowsだと厳しいかもしれませんが…,っていうかreadlineが使えないか?)。 ダウンロード ソースはgithubにあります。 ・GitHub - mmisono/Skysh: Skype in Terminal 必要な物: ・Skype4Py ・termcolor 以上の2つはダウンロードして、 % python setu
はじめに 以前、知人のやっているBeProudという会社を手伝ったのですが、BeProudでは、エンジニアの主要なコミュニケーション手段としてSkypeが使われていました。当時、趣味でたまたまSkypeのAPIについて調べていたので、悪戯っ気を出して、開発環境に即席でSkype APIを使ったbotを設置してみたところ、思いのほか好評を博し、いまやインフラと言っても過言ではない存在 *1 *2と化したようです。 まあそんな状況を眺めつつ、自宅のサーバにSkype botを設置して、お気に入りのSkypeチャットにもbotを加えてみたところ、これも結構好評だったので、興味ありそうな人向けに作成方法をまとめることにします。 Skype Public API Skype Public APIとは、Skypeを外部からコントロールするためのインターフェイスです。 Skype Public APIを
Skypeをサーバーで動かす Skypeをデーモンとして立ち上げるためのスクリプト: http://gist.github.com/557242 via http://twitter.com/moriyoshit/status/25334383350 MacbookでSkype4Pyを動かすための準備 Pythonを32bit起動しないといけないので*1、次のコマンドを実行。MacPortsで入れたpythonを使う場合はまた別のやり方になる。 defaults write com.apple.versioner.python Prefer-32-Bit -bool yes Skype4Py 10.0.32.0はそのままでは動かないので次のパッチを当てる。*2 --- Skype4Py.orig/api/darwin.py 2009-09-25 06:13:41.000000000 -04
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く